Subject: Pickpath optimizer v1.4 heading to staging

Hi all — especially the new folks!

The Pickpath warehouse pick-list optimizer just landed in staging. Short version: routes are now batched by aisle cluster, which cut walk time about 12% in the Dunmarsh trial. If you're shadowing a release for the first time, this one's a nice gentle intro — low blast radius, easy rollback. The staging build token is right below.

session token of yahof-bajeg = htk9_0d43d44ed

Action item from the Fernhollow incident: uploaded profile photos bypassed EXIF scrubbing when the pipeline hit a timeout, so GPS tags reached the CDN for roughly six hours. Fix: make scrubbing a blocking step before publish, fail closed on timeout, and backfill-scrub all assets uploaded during the window. As a new contractor, start with the backfill script. The scrubbing pipeline overview is on the internal page below.

dashboard of bafof-hafog = https://confluence.lumiclabs.internal/display/browse/display/6a09a20a

## Deploying the Gatewick Proctor Queue

Deploys are pretty painless: push to main, wait for the pipeline, then watch the queue drain dashboard for five minutes. If candidates pile up mid-exam, roll back first and ask questions later — the queue replays safely. Everything the workers care about lives in one config block, shown here for reference.

settings of bafof-yagef:
JOROX_PIN=8740
JOROX_TENANT=pelox
JOROX_METRICS_HOST=metrics.jorox.qorvelworks.internal
JOROX_SEAL=seal_c78f63c1
JOROX_STANDBY_TEAM=norax